ugrás a tartalomhoz

Archívum - Dec 27, 2004 - Fórum téma

php class trükkök

Anonymous · 2004. Dec. 27. (H), 21.57
php 4 és php 5 osztálykezelésével kapcsolatos problémák, és azok megoldásai.
 

az adatbázisból formázott text kiíratása php-ből?

Anonymous · 2004. Dec. 27. (H), 13.54
Sziasztok !

Egy kis segítség kellene, van egy adatbázis mezőm amit egy textarea-n keresztül töltök fel, ebben szerepelhetnek, sortörések, felsorolások, tab-ok, space-k. Az adatbázisba jól viszi be, ugyanolyannak látom a tartalmat mint amit felvittem, a probléma akkor következik, ha ezt a mezőt egy tömböl ki szeretném íratni, akkor ugyanis se a sortörést se a spaceket, se semmit nem rak bele, hanem egy egybeömlesztett szöveget rak ki a képernyőre. Már próbálkoztam a nl2br() függvénnyel is, akkor valamivel jobb a helyzet legalább a sortöréseket kiírja.
Mit lehet ilyenkor tenni? Már tömbbe ömlesztve kerülnek bele az adatok vagy a kiíratás módja nem stimel?

Előre is köszönöm a segítséget.
 

Megengedhető, hogy csak egy felbontásra készüljünk fel?

Vadember · 2004. Dec. 27. (H), 13.22
Hali! Szerintetek megengedhető az, hogy egy weboldalt csak egyfajta felbontásra készítünk és figyelmeztetjük a felhasználót a helyes felbontás használatára. Vagy ma már az alapkövetelmény hogy legalább 800*600 és 1024*768-ban is normálisan kell kinéznie ? Észrevételem szerint ma ez a két legelterjedtebb felbontás.
 

MySQL lekérdezés/kiíratás

Anonymous · 2004. Dec. 27. (H), 12.36
Hello

Visszaolvastam pár lapot, de még mindig nem találtam választ...

Van nekem egy MySQL adatbázisom, egy 'linkek' táblám, és abba bele vannak írva, a linkek, tehát: leir (leírás), link (hogy hova mutat), kat (a kategória, ezzel van a probléma) és nev (hogy ki adta hozzá a listához).

Na most amikor új linket akarnánk hozzáadni, minden kategóriát ki szeretnék íratni egy <select> -be, ami megy is, csak ha MP3 kategóriában tíz link van, akkor tíz MP3 <option> lesz a <select> -ben, pedig én csak egyet szeretnék.

Tehát az egész így néz ki valahogy:

<form action="index.php?o=linkek&ao=uj" method="post" name="ujlink" target="_top" id="ujlink">
<p>Le&iacute;r&aacute;s:
<input name="ujlink_leir" type="text" id="ujlink_leir" size="30" maxlength="255">
</p>
<p>Link: http://
<input name="ujlink_link" type="text" id="ujlink_link" size="30" maxlength="255">
</p>
<p>Kateg&oacute;ria: </p>
<ul>
<li>Megl&eacute;v&#337; kateg&oacute;ri&aacute;k k&ouml;z&uuml;l kiv&aacute;laszt&aacute;s:<br>
<select name="kat1" size="3" id="select">
<?php
// adatbázis kapcsolódás
$db=mysql_connect("host","db","pwd");
mysql_select_db(klick, $db);
// kategóriatípusok kiiratása
$eredmeny=mysql_db_query("db","SELECT kat FROM linkek");
while($sor=mysql_fetch_array($eredmeny))
{
echo" <option value\"".$sor["kat"]."\">".$sor["kat"]."</option>\n";
}
mysql_free_result($eredmeny);
?>
</select>
</li>
<li>&Uacute;j keteg&oacute;ria (hagyd &uuml;resen, ha kiv&aacute;lasztott&aacute;l kateg&oacute;ri&aacute;t):<br>
<input name="ujlink_kat2" type="text" id="ujlink_kat2" size="30" maxlength="255">
</li>
</ul>
</form>

Tehát az a lényeg hogy a link hozzáadásakor új kategóriát is létre lehesenn hozni, de nem szeretnék a kategórianeveknek külön táblát, és kategóriánként sem külön táblákat.

Ha valaki megértette, akkor örömmel venném válaszát.

Víznedvesítő